
Sanford Biggers and For Freedoms
11/6/2019 | 26m 46sVideo has Closed Captions
Maria Brito meets Sanford Biggers and For Freedom’s Hank Willis Thomas and Eric Gottesman.
Maria Brito and artist Sanford Biggers discuss issues related to syncretism, black history, police brutality and the influences that jazz and hip-hop have had on Sanford’s multimedia practice. Then she meets Hank Willis Thomas and Eric Gottesman, co-founders of the collective For Freedoms, to discuss freedom in America, voting rights and art as a medium for participatory engagement.
